flytire 0 Report post Posted Saturday at 03:02 PM Green Devil Tail - Golden pheasant tippet fibers Body - Green floss Rib - Scarlet copper tinsel Hackle - Scarlet Wing - Brown speckled wing quill from Capercaillie* *I used woodcock Ingvar Jeremiassen Originator Fly2000 Database Quote Share this post Link to post Share on other sites

flytire 0 Report post Posted 21 hours ago Ford's Favorite Body - Blue floss Hackle - Grizzly hackle Wing - Grey wing quill from snipe or slate duck or goose quillsegments Thomas Ford. Made in 1890. Fly2000 Database Quote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
flytire 0 Report post Posted 18 hours ago Jensen Tail - Golden pheasant tippet fibers Body - ½ flat golden tinsel, ½ claret wool Rib - Oval gold tinsel Hackle - Brown Wing - Brown mallard (aka bronze mallard) Fly2000 Database Quote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
